METHOD FOR OPERATING MONO-FUEL COMBUSTION BOILER HAVING FUEL OF HOT BLAST FURNACE GAS

机译:具有高炉煤气燃料的单燃料燃烧锅炉的操作方法

摘要

PURPOSE:To enable a stable operation of a boiler to be performed only with a hot blast furnace gas (BFG) as a fuel by a method wherein a part of blast gas is fed together with water vapor into a reaction device in which a catalyst layer can exchange heat with a thermal medium, hydrogen is generated and a modified blast gas having the got hydrogen as its major constituent is used as a flame stabling fuel gas. CONSTITUTION:BFG gas generated in a blast furnace 1 is fed to a boiler 6 through BFG pipe 1a and a part of BFG gas is passed through a branch pipe 1b and then fed to a low quality steam fed from a steam pipe 2 to a reaction device 3. In this case, the modified BFG having a large amount of hydrogen is fed directly to the boiler 6 through a pipe 5 as a flame stabling fuel. Quality improved off-gas is returned back to a pipe 1a through a pipe 1c. Both BFG supplied from a catalyst layer inlet 12 of a reaction device 3a and low quality steam are processed such that CO in BFG is modified to H2 under a shift reaction with steam at the catalyst layer 13, this H2 is simultaneously passed and separated in porous material pipe 14, H2 is selectively removed to generate a modified BFG having a large amount of H2 and then passed through gas outlets 18 and 19 and guided to the boiler 6 under operation of a vacuum pump 21.
